Seems in fact that the KTU84L patch works just as well on KTU84P.

Just updated with fastboot, to flash boot.img and system.img. Then reflash the GuyAdams patch, wipe Dalvik & Cache, then reboot.

All working fine with 8SMS for sms, and running a wifi tether.

Doesn't seem to work on KTU84P

I reflashed to completely stock, did a factory reset, rooted, installed a custom recovery, and then applied the SMS/WiFi Tethering ZIP for KTU84P. The flash of the zip completed successfully and I rebooted to the system.

I do not have a menu for Tethering & Mobile hotspot in settings.

Has anyone else been able to get this to work on KTU84P?

---------- Post added at 09:42 AM ---------- Previous post was at 09:10 AM ----------

Here is some additional information on my issue.

First, I'm using an AT&T SIM in the US.

If I enable airplane mode and reboot, the Tethering & mobile hotspot menu appears. I can go into the settings and setup the SSID and security the way I want it. As soon as I turn off airplane more and it connects to AT&T, the menu option disappears. Of course then there is no way to enable the hotspot. So I downloaded a hotspot toggle widget from the Play store. I had to enable airplane mode and reboot again just to add the widget to my home screen.

Then I could turn off airplane mode to enable the 3G radio. When I tap the hotspot toggle widget, it does turn on the hotspot. I can see the hotspot from my PC and connect to it. The only issue is there does not appear to be a functioning DHCP server on the Nexus 7 as the PC doesn't get an IP address so it automatically assigns one. Of course that IP address is probably not in the correct IP range, subnet mask, or default gateway, so I cannot connect to the Internet from my PC.
